Overview

In this assignment, you will explore key concepts related to social justice, including justice, fairness, equality, and bias. You will also explore how narratives affect perceptions of social justice and core principles of social justice. This part of the project will be the basis for the rest of your project and will help you apply your knowledge of concepts related to social justice.

Directions

First, consult the Project Guidelines and Rubric to review the scope of the project and the provided scenarios. Next, review the Project Scenarios document and select a scenario. Choose a scenario for this assignment carefully, because you will use the same scenario for the project. Then, with your chosen scenario in mind, address the assignment prompts by completing Part One in the Project Template.

Note: You can find the Project Template linked in the What to Submit section. You can find the Project Guidelines and Rubric and the Project Scenarios document linked in the Supporting Materials section.

Specifically, you must address the following:

Project Part One: Social Justice
  1. Explain the difference between justice, fairness, and equality as they apply in the chosen scenario.
  2. Describe how bias could impact social justice in the chosen scenario.
  3. Explain how different narratives circulating in society could impact how social justice is perceived in the chosen scenario.
  4. Explain the core principles of social justice in the chosen scenario.

What to Submit

Submit your Project Template for grading. You will use the same Project Template for all of the project drafts and for the project. For this assignment, you will complete only Part One of the Project Template. No sources are required.
